User manual COMFR ___ FAN______DEFR ALFANET 75 C Cool Defr Thermostat with fan control mel VDH doc 002465 Version v1 1 Date 15 02 2005 Software ALFA NET 75 File Do002465 WP8 Range 50 0 50 0 C Description The ALFANET 75 is a cool defrost thermostat with various defrost and fan control settings And it is controllable on the PC thru the ALFANET PC INTERFACE Installation On the top side of the ALFANET 75 is shown how the sensor power supply and relays has to be connected After connecting the ALFANET 75 to the power supply a self test function is started As this test is finished the measured temperature of the temperature sensor control appears in the display Control The ALFANET 75 thermostat can be controlled by four push buttons on the front These keys are SET view change the setpoint UP increase value DOWN decrease value C hidden push button above SET key and behind C symbol View setpoint By pushing the SET key the setpoint appears in the display The decimal point of the last display starts blinking to indicate this After a few seconds after releasing the SET key the setpoint disappears and the measured temperature is shown again Changing setpoint Push the SET key and the setpoint appears in the display Release the SET key Now push the SET key again together with the UP or DOWN keys to change the setpoint After a few seconds after releasing the SET key the s
5. e error message alternated is the alarm solved then the error message disappears and the temperature is displayed normally Fan control The ALFANET 75 has several parameters for fan control Normally the fan is always active accept for one of the following parameters is set to 1 the fan can be stopped Parameter 20 1 Fan switch differential active The fan is only active when the defrost temperature is parameter 21 lower than the measured product temperature Fanon Toe lt T contro Tug P21 As there are no further conditions to switch the fan off Parameter 25 26 Fan on delay after defrost The fan is switched off during defrost and to prevent blowing in hot air in the cabin after defrost and the dripping off time parameter 27 there are two conditions which can be set a The fan is blocked until the defrost sensor measures a temperature lower than the temperature setting of parameter 25 b The fan is blocked until the defrost delay time of parameter 26 has stopped Unless the defrost sensor has reached the temperature setting of parameter 25 Parameter 22 1 Compressor off than Fan off The fan deactivates as the compressor deactivates with a delay of parameter 23 minutes Provided that there are no other conditions to deactivates the fan Defrost control The automatic defrost is started by the defrost cycle time P30 and stopped by the maximum defrost time P31 or sooner by reaching the maximum defrost tem

7. etpoint disappears and the measured temperature is shown again Status of the Relays By pushing the hidden C key the display shows the status of the relays Each display segment shows the status of the relay output showing 02 off and 1 on The code 110 means relay 1 compr en relay 2 fan are on and relay 3 defr is off Manual starting stopping of defrost The defrost cycle is automatic started and stopped These defrost settings thru internal parameters Stop defrost If there is a defrost cycle the defrost can be manually stopped by pushing the UP and the DOWN key simultaneously Start defrost If there is no defrost cycle the defrost can be manually started by pushing the UP and the DOWN key simultaneously Setting internal parameters Next to the adjustment of the setpoint some internal settings are possible like differentials sensor adjustments setpoint range compressor fan defrost and alarm settings By pushing the DOWN key for more than 10 seconds you enter the internal programming menu In the left display the upper and the lower segments are blinking Over the UP and DOWN keys the required parameter can be selected see table for the parameters If the required parameter is selected the value can be read out by pushing the SET key Pushing the UP and DOWN keys allows you to change the value of this parameter If after 20 seconds no key is pushed the ALFANET 75 changes to it s normal operation mode
8. perature P32 Further has the ALFANET 75 additional parameters to control defrost Parameter 24 Defrost mode The ALFANET 75 has two defrost modes P24 0 While defrosting only the Fan activates Natural defrost P24 1 While defrosting the relay DEFR activates Hotgas Electrical defrost Parameter 34 0 Defrost at fixed interval time In this case parameter 30 is the chosen interval time Parameter 34 1 Defrost based on total Compressor time In this case the Defrost is started as the Compressor has been activated for parameter 30 hours Parameter 36 1 The ALFANET 75 starts with Defrost on Power up After Power up the ALFANET 75 first starts with a delay of parameter 37 minutes before starting Defrost while in delay the ALFANET 75 works normally Parameter 33 1 Compressor active at Defrost P24 1 For hot gas Defrost systems the Compressor needs to be activated while defrosting After Defrost the Drip off time parameter 27 starts During this time the defrost relay and the compressor are not active so the Cool unit can drip off Parameters ALFANET 75 Para Description Parameter Range Default meter Value Switching differential 15 0 C Minimum setpoint eo Seb Cc Maximum setpoint 50 50 C Read out above 10 C per 1 C OzNo 1 Yes Offset Control sensor 15 0 415 0 C Read out Defrost sensor Offset Defrost sensor 15 0 415 0 C Start up delay Cooling 0 99 Switch off delay Cooling 0 99 Param
